Corn- and Pepper-Stuffed Zucchini

Prep Time:
10 minutes
Total Time:
15 minutes
Try this delicious corn and pepper stuffed zucchini - a quick and delightful side dish. Ready in 15 minutes!
Ingredients:
  • 4 small zucchini (about 6 inches long)
  • 1 tablespoon water
  • 3/4 cup frozen (thawed) whole kernel corn or cooled cooked fresh corn kernels
  • 2 tablespoons diced red bell pepper
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h or 1/2 teaspoon dried basil leaves
  • 2 medium green onions, thinly sliced (2 tablespoons)
  • 2 teaspoons olive or canola oil
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t
Instructions:
  • Halve the zucchini lengthwise and place it in a microwavable dish measuring 11x7x1 1/2 inches with some water. Cover the dish with plastic wrap, leaving a small opening to vent steam.
  • Microwave the zucchini on high for 3 to 5 minutes until crisp-tender. Once cooled, hollow out the centers of the zucchini, leaving 1/4-inch thick shells. Dispose of the centers.
  • Combine all the ingredients and fill each zucchini shell with approximately 2 tablespoons of the corn mixture.
